To start with, coffee high quality is calculated by examining the environmentally friendly coffee bean. After the cherry is picked with the plant, it goes through a depulping and drying procedure to supply what is recognized as “green coffee”. It’s then graded using the Specialty Coffee Affiliation’s Classification System.
